[发明专利]一种不确定网络环境下的链路丢包率推理方法有效
申请号: | 201810126298.9 | 申请日: | 2018-02-08 |
公开(公告)号: | CN108400907B | 公开(公告)日: | 2021-06-01 |
发明(设计)人: | 乔焰;王静;叶玉琪;俞新蕾;焦俊;马慧敏;王婧 | 申请(专利权)人: | 安徽农业大学 |
主分类号: | H04L12/26 | 分类号: | H04L12/26;H04L12/24 |
代理公司: | 安徽合肥华信知识产权代理有限公司 34112 | 代理人: | 余成俊 |
地址: | 230036 安徽*** | 国省代码: | 安徽;34 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了一种不确定网络环境下的链路丢包率推理方法,包括以下步骤:(101)、获取目标网络的拓扑;(102)、发送端到端探测并接收探测结果,该探测结果就是探测得到的路径丢包率;(103)、根据路径丢包率确定路径状态,从而确定链路状态;(104)、采用对数正态分布拟合可得到1状态和2状态链路的丢包率范围;(105)、输出所有的链路丢包率范围。本发明改进了现有技术的相关算法和流程,提出了一个在真实网络环境下面对不确定因素的丢包推理方法,大大地提高了测量链路丢包率的正确率。 | ||
搜索关键词: | 一种 不确定 网络 环境 链路丢包率 推理 方法 | ||
【主权项】:
1.一种不确定网络环境下的链路丢包率推理方法,其特征在于:包括以下步骤:(101)、获取目标网络的拓扑:上层的故障管理系统通过接口采集设备网管中设备间互联的链路信息,重新组建需进行故障定位的目标网络拓扑;(102)、发送端到端探测并接收探测结果,该探测结果就是探测得到的路径丢包率;(103)、根据路径丢包率确定路径状态,从而确定链路状态,具体过程如下:(301)、每次选取网络中没有被确定状态的最长的路径,即先从通过链路最多的路径开始推理;(302)、通过推理每个链路的丢包率的范围代替推测每个链路的确切丢包率,其中定义丢包率在0~0.02为0状态,0状态表示链路或路径不丢包,0状态的链路不会对网络环境有较大的影响;丢包率在0.02~0.15为1状态,1状态表示链路或路径轻微丢包;丢包率大于0.15为2状态,2状态表示链路或路径严重丢包;轻微丢包和严重丢包的链路会影响网络的通信,确定状态后还需进一步给出其确定的丢包率,而确定的丢包率可根据步骤(102)端到端的探测得到;(303)、链路丢包率和路径丢包率有这样一个关系,若一条路径通过至少一条丢包的链路,这条路径也会表现出丢包,也就是说若一条路径为1状态或者2状态,那么这条路径上的链路至少有一条是1状态或者2状态,但是不能确定哪几条是丢包的链路;同样,如果一条路径上的所有链路都是不丢包的链路,那么这条路径表现出不丢包,即不丢包的路径上的链路都是不丢包的链路;近似将通过某条路径的链路标记为与该路径相同的状态;在确定链路的状态的时候需要一个参数作为限制参数,当通过某条链路0状态/1状态/2状态路径的个数/通过该链路所有的路径数>=参数时,才能确定这条链路的状态,因为网络中存在大量的0状态的链路,而且0状态的链路不需要确定具体的丢包率,因此先确定0状态的链路,确定出0状态的链路之后,删除路径中0状态链路和随后出现的冗余路径来简化网络环境;(304)、当网络中所有的路径都得到了标记,再用同样的参数来确定1状态和2状态的链路;(104)、采用对数正态分布拟合可得到1状态和2状态链路的丢包率范围:将步骤(103)得到的每一个1状态以及2状态的链路,分别找出相应的通过该链路的所有路径的丢包率,对每一个链路得到的路径丢包率进行对数正态分布拟合,确定该链路的丢包率范围;(105)、输出所有的链路丢包率范围。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于安徽农业大学,未经安徽农业大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201810126298.9/,转载请声明来源钻瓜专利网。